Output d74cc2a81daa1a499e6c13f51dbd7527f64cf885152e92c5fe779979bcfdc528:1

value
21681648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b1fb1e1307c95dfb75718238f960537023a6111 OP_EQUAL
address
375dm4KNotXfj1t5TW9axNz9awj8EtQ7Hp
transaction
d74cc2a81daa1a499e6c13f51dbd7527f64cf885152e92c5fe779979bcfdc528
spent
true